What are High Bay LED Lights with Motion Sensors?

The high bay LED lights with motion sensors are designed to maintain a secure environment by being used to illuminate the lights when needed. Usually, the motion sensors detect movements allowing the lighting fixture to disperse brightness throughout the area. With the help of this amazing feature, you can save a considerable amount of electricity by illuminating the area only when brightness is a need. The 3-step-dimming motion and daylight sensor are built into the lighting fixture to give an automatic lighting performance with 1V to 10V interface of dimming. It will be helpful for any commercial premise where lighting can effectively increase or decrease the utility cost.

Color Temperature

High Bay LED Lights with Motion Sensors

The color temperature of the lights shows the lighting color that you will get in your area under the brightness. Usually, the CCT is measured by the Kelvin unit, denoted as K. It is simple to understand that lower Kelvin ranges from 2700K to 3500K indicate that the light will disperse a warm white light. Along with this, the rating goes from 4000K to 5000K will provide cool white light throughout the area. Finally, daylight white light will be dispersed by the lighting fixture with a rating ranging from 5700K to 6500K. Thus, you have the option to choose the desired color temperature for your premise according to your need.

Mounting Option

The mounting options available in the lighting fixture are much beneficial for you. For example, high bay LED lights come with a chain mounting option that can easily fit with the fixture and the ceiling. You just need to attach the lighting fixture to the chain hook and then mount the chain from the other end to the ceiling. With the help of the chain, you can maintain a gap between the ceiling and the lighting fixture.
